The state of Ghana has big debts. The "restructuring" entailed forcing creditors to give up some of their claims and exchanging the rest in to longer term government bonds. That some creditors still have not accepted this, is actually a big problem. The condition creditors have set, is that all other creditors must accept the same "haircut", as the former government nicely put it. If only one is paid in full, all others have to be paid in full.
This killed a similar deal Argentina tried to make some years back. It must have the governments full focus.
